- 12 ounces brussels sprouts sliced in half
- ¾ tablespoon extra virgin olive oil
- ⅓ teaspoon garlic powder
- ⅛ teaspoon ground black pepper
- ½ cup freshly grated parmesan cheese
Preheat air fryer to 390° Fahrenheit.
Wash the brussels sprouts, rinse and pat dry.
Trim stubbly ends and remove all lose leaves, then slice each brussels sprout in half.
Place in bowl with oil, garlic powder, salt and pepper. Toss well.
Arrange in air fryser with flat side up. Be sure to space evenly for plenty of air flow. This prevents it from steaming.
Cook for 8 minutes. Remove basket and shake the brussels sprouts. Top with parmesan cheese and cook another 8-10 minutes until crisp.
